Yard leveling services involve adjusting the terrain of a property’s yard to create a more even and stable surface. This process typically includes removing high spots, filling in low areas, and grading the land to ensure proper drainage and a smooth, uniform appearance. Skilled service providers use specialized equipment and techniques to reshape the yard, which can improve both the aesthetic appeal and functionality of outdoor spaces. Proper yard leveling can help prevent issues such as soil erosion, pooling water, and uneven ground that can make outdoor activities difficult or unsafe.
Many property owners seek yard leveling to address common problems caused by uneven terrain. These issues often include water pooling after rain, which can lead to muddy patches or even foundation problems if water seeps into the home’s foundation. Uneven yards can also create tripping hazards or make it difficult to mow and maintain the lawn. In some cases, yard leveling is necessary after construction or landscaping projects that disturb the natural grade of the land. Addressing these problems with professional yard leveling can help protect the property and make outdoor spaces safer and more enjoyable.

The overview below groups typical Yard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Rapid City, SD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or yard leveling projects range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ering small adjustments or fixing uneven spots. Fewer projects reach into the higher end of this spectrum.
Medium-sized Projects - Larger yard leveling tasks usually c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ects often involve more extensive grading or soil redistribution and are common for average residential properties. Some complex jobs may exceed this range.
Complete Yard Reshaping - Full yard leveling or significant landscape reshaping can cost from $1,500 to $3,500. These larger projects are less frequent but necessary for major grading or slope correction on larger properties.
Full Replacement or Major Overhaul - Extensive yard renovations, including complete removal and regrading, can reach $3,500 to $5,000+ depending on size and complexity. Such projects are less common and typically involve substantial soil work or structural adjustments.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
